Types of Turning Cutting Holders : A Detailed Review
Selecting the appropriate tool holder is vital for effective turning operations. Primarily, these exist in several types . Rectangular tool holders are common and provide a simple approach for basic turning . Round holders often used for intricate operations and give greater flexibility. Then there are short length holders designed for small work spaces. Finally, dynamically damped holders are used to minimize chatter and improve part appearance. Each kind has its own perks and disadvantages to consider .

Cutting Tool Selection: Aligning the Device to the Task
Proper choosing the correct cutting tool is absolutely important for ensuring optimal performance in any metalworking operation . Carefully evaluating factors like the stock being shaped, its hardness , the desired surface , and the nature of machining being created get more info – if it's a roughing pass or a final one – is essential to optimize cutter duration , lessen vibration , and obtain the predicted exactness. Ultimately , a skilled machinist recognizes that implement selection isn’t just a question of opinion, but a core aspect of productive machining .
